Eagle Pcb Gcode Software Cable OfUsed Software. DipTrace: CopperCAM: Mach3: I used DipTrace form y PCB Layouts but any software cable of saving Gerber files can be used. To control my CNC Mill I use Mach 3, but any other software can be used such as LinuxCNC and EMC2. But for me I think the 175 for a Mach 3 License is well spend since its a great peace of software. Eagle Pcb Gcode License For CopperCAMI also got an license for CopperCAM for 80 which is good given out and dont have to mangle with a lot of conversation programs and scripts. Select File Export NC Drill Check the settings and click Export chose Yes to use the automatically tools and save the File eg. Through.drl Then Close DipTrace and start CopperCAM. Add Tip Ask Question Comment Download Step 2: Exporting G-Code in CopperCAM Start CopperCAM Goto Files Open New Circuit. Select the Calculate isolating toolpaths icon, select the number of extra contours the engraving bit shall run abound the tracks. The view is from the Top thru the board to it have to be inverted. For my example 1: 10 degree V-Bit for Engraving 2: 1,3 mm Drill for Cutting 3: 0,8 mm Drill for drilling 0,8 mm holes. Drill for drilling all 1,2 mm holes and those a bow. And click OK Select File Origin Enter the values X2 and Y2 and select OK This will change the Origin Point where the CNC will start from so that the start point is where the corner of the board so that you easily can position the CNC and dont get too much waist material. I change under Drilling Tools Use for each drill the closest small tool, with circular boring And Allow circular boring for all holes over is set to 1 mm. In my setup, it will then end up with one file for 0,8 mm drilling and one for 1,2 mm and it will then use the 1,2 mm drill for all holes witch is bigger, this saves me a lot of changing drills since I can do it all with only 2 drills. Click OK Then to the last steps exporting the G-Code for the tools. Select Section 1 and chose Engraving layer 1 check the Flip X box. Select OK, this will Open a Notepad windows with the G-Code for the selected task. Save that eg. As Engrave.txt. Click the Mill Icon again and change the Section 1 to Drilling (Tool 3 0,8) check the Flip X box. Select OK, this will again Open a Notepad windows with the G-Code for the selected task. Save that eg. As drill08.txt. Click the Mill Icon again and change the Section 1 to Drilling (Tool 4 1,2) check the Flip X box. Save that eg. As drill12.txt. Click the Mill Icon again and change the Section 1 to Cutting out check the Flip X box. ![]() Now you have 4 files with G-Code for the necessary tasks.
